Our solutions for offshore energy at a glance…
-
Safesee™
Visualise global and site-specific meteorological and oceanographic information, like wind and wave.
-
SafeVoyage™
Identify safe weather windows for planning the route of a vessel, towing operations or moving equipment and crew. Obtain 5-day ahead forecasts whilst at sea.
-
Tab and Graph
5-day ahead site-specific forecasts for the management of your day-to-day operations.
-
Probability forecasts for offshore operations
15-day forecasts displaying wave height, mean wave direction, mean wave period, wind speed and wind direction. Please see the user guide for further information.
-
Telephone Briefings
Schedule telephone briefings with a Met Office meteorologist for specific locations and routes including required weather parameters and thresholds.
-
On-site senior operational meteorologist
Request a Met Office meteorologist to attend planning and safety meetings during times of weather-sensitive operations.
-
Buoys
Deploy observation buoys to capture real-time weather and marine data for offshore, coastal and inshore environments.
-
Metocean consultancy
Bespoke analyses for downtime, weather windows, frequency distributions and operational delays using hindcast datasets and statistical modelling techniques.
Additional Services
-
Surge forecasts
Obtain specialist forecasts to predict water levels in ports, harbours and the likelihood of flooding.
-
2D spectral wave data
Get detailed information to understand the impact of seas on the motion of vessels.
-
Weather warnings
Receive bespoke warnings for weather types like lightning, high winds and extreme weather.
-
Offshore Meterological Observing Refresher Course
Train your staff to make weather observations in support of your offshore helicopter operations. We are a CAA certified provider of offshore meteorological training in compliance with CAP 437.
